Apple Watch ultra users by [deleted] in Ultramarathon

[–]writer8832 4 points5 points  (0 children)

I used the AWU for an ultra that took me 12 hours. I used it on low power mode, had notifications and everything left on, but I didn’t try music streaming. Had 75% left. I was really surprised.

For ultras I always carry my phone. Adds an extra layer of safety for calls if the watch dies, plus photos etc. if the mood strikes. Plus it’s not like a road marathon, you’re already carrying a ton of stuff so a phone really doesn’t make much difference

Edit: I would just add, if anything is going to kill the battery it would be constantly look for phone signal. If your race is in a spotty area I’d keep that in mind.
